​Pacira BioSciences, Inc. (Nasdaq: PCRX) is committed to providing a non-opioid option to as many patients as possible to redefine the role of opioids as rescue therapy only. Pacira has three commercial-stage non-opioid treatments: EXPAREL® (bupivacaine liposome injectable suspension), a long-acting, local analgesia approved for postsurgical pain management; ZILRETTA® (triamcinolone acetonide extended-release injectable suspension), an extended-release, intra-articular, injection indicated for the management of osteoarthritis knee pain; and ioveraº®, a novel, handheld device for delivering immediate, long-acting, drug-free pain control using precise, controlled doses of cold temperature to a targeted nerve. SI-BONE, Inc. is a leading medical device company that has developed the iFuse Implant System®, a proprietary minimally invasive surgical implant system to fuse the sacroiliac joint. The iFuse Implant, available since 2009, is the only device for treatment of SI joint dysfunction supported by significant published clinical evidence, including level 1 trials, showing safety, effectiveness and durability, including lasting pain relief.

Vericel develops, manufactures, and markets autologous cell-based therapies for patients with serious diseases and conditions. The company markets MACI® (autologous cultured chondrocytes on porcine collagen membrane), a third generation autologous cellularized scaffold product that is indicated for the repair of single or multiple symptomatic, full-thickness cartilage defects of the adult knee, with or without bone involvement.
